Ok a little hard to read but the Rank vs Poverty index with order based on Poverty index (mostly 2010 numbers, lower is better) shows that "richer" schools seem to rank higher. With few exceptions poorer schools are not ranking very high but it still is not the whole story. Dorman is almost Wando's size but is much poorer and ranks well below Mauldin which is much smaller (2/3 Dormans size) but is richer. Wonder if the closeness of CESA and the number of club players helps Mauldin in this case? In fact most of the high ranked teams are clustered around Club strong areas.

(PLEASE NOTE NO SLIGHTS INTENED TO ANY AREA/SCHOOL WITH THE TERMS POORER OR RICHER, JUST USING GENERAL TERMS, NUMBERS COME FROM STATE DEPT OF ED WEB SITE)

with the loss of S. Aiken, Riverside and JL Mann 3a womens soccer has taken a big hit.looking at the top teams in 3a it is extremely weak.Unlike in years past the top 3a teams won't even be competitive playing 4a schools this year. All of the good soccer will be played in 4a. SCHSL needs to throw out the 48/48/48 rule, and actually look at the size of each school. There are 1600 pupil discrepancies between the larger 4a's and the smaller 4a's. You don't have this in 3a. In other sports like football Riverside doesn't stand a chance against the Dormans, Wando's and Byrnes.
